In the NFL, each team typically has one quality control coach for both the offensive and defensive sides of the ball, totaling two quality control coaches per team. These coaches assist in breaking down game film, preparing game plans, and contributing to player development. However, the exact number can vary by team, as some may have additional quality control staff or different titles within their coaching staff structure.
